当前位置:主页 > 资讯 >

                              如何计算区块链钱包?

                              时间:2024-05-04 18:39:41 来源:未知 点击:

                              区块链技术作为一种去中心化的技术,在金融领域得到了广泛的应用。在区块链网络中,账户的安全由其所拥有的私钥来保障,拥有私钥即拥有账户的控制权。而钱包是存储私钥的软件,用户需要正确使用钱包才能管理自己的数字资产。本文将介绍如何计算区块链钱包,包括私钥、公钥、数字签名以及交易记录,以帮助读者更好地理解区块链钱包的工作原理。

                              什么是区块链钱包?

                              区块链钱包是一种数字货币钱包,也称为数字钱包。它可以存储私钥和公钥,并允许用户进行加密货币的转移和接收。钱包可以安装在个人电脑、移动设备或者专门的硬件中。目前市面上的数字货币钱包主要包括桌面钱包、移动钱包、硬件钱包等。

                              如何生成私钥和公钥?

                              如何计算区块链钱包? 区块链钱包里最重要的是私钥和公钥。私钥是一段由随机数生成的字符串,用于对账户进行数字签名和接收数字资产。而公钥是由私钥生成的一串字符,用于在区块链网络中确认账户的所有者身份。私钥和公钥之间具有一一对应关系。 通常区块链钱包会使用一种被称为椭圆曲线加密算法生成公钥和私钥。此算法有两个参数,一个是曲线参数,另外一个是基点。用户在使用钱包时,可以根据这两个参数生成随机的私钥。私钥生成后,通过椭圆曲线算法可以生成对应的公钥。

                              如何进行数字签名?

                              数字签名是指使用私钥对某些信息进行标记,以证明该信息确实是由持有私钥的人发送的。在区块链网络中,数字签名用于验证交易是否是有效的。数字签名的过程如下: 1. 使用哈希算法将原始数据转为一个哈希值; 2. 使用私钥对哈希值进行加密,得到数字签名; 3. 将原始数据、哈希值和数字签名组成一个交易记录,并发送到区块链网络上。 收到交易记录的节点,可以使用公钥和哈希算法来验证数字签名的有效性。如果验证通过,则认为交易记录是合法的。

                              如何记录交易记录?

                              如何计算区块链钱包? 在区块链钱包中,交易记录是通过记录区块链上交易的方式来实现的。这些交易记录是分散存储在每个节点上的,节点之间通过点对点网络传输交易信息。每个交易记录包括发送方、接收方、交易数量和交易时间等信息。 每个交易记录都必须包含数字签名以及哈希值,以确保交易的有效性。当交易被确认后,系统会在区块链上生成一个新的交易块,并将交易记录添加到该块中。

                              如何管理区块链钱包?

                              为了保障用户的私钥安全,区块链钱包需要进行充分的安全管理。以下是几个常见的安全管理策略: 1. 备份私钥:钱包私钥是用户开启区块链钱包的凭证,如果用户将其丢失或者遗忘则无法再次访问数字资产。因此用户需要在安全场所备份私钥。 2. 使用硬件钱包:硬件钱包是一种相对安全的钱包,它可以将用户的私钥存储在脱机状态的设备中,只有在有需要时才会将私钥转移到联网的设备上进行数字签名。 3. 设置钱包密码:用户需要为钱包设置一个足够强度的密码,以防止非法访问和攻击。 4. 更新钱包软件:如同其他软件一样,钱包软件也需要经常更新,以修复漏洞和改进性能。

                              如何选择适合自己的区块链钱包?

                              最后,选择适合自己的区块链钱包也是非常重要的一件事。因为不同的钱包适用于不同的用途。下面给出几个选择钱包的建议: 1. 如果需要频繁进行数字货币的交易,则建议选择移动钱包。移动钱包支持快速的交易和支付,并且交易的手续费也相对较低。 2. 如果需要将大量的数字货币保存在钱包中,则建议选择硬件钱包,硬件钱包相对安全,并且支持多种数字货币的存储。 3. 如果使用钱包的主要目的是挖矿,则建议选择桌面钱包,桌面钱包支持自定义挖矿设置,并且交易处理速度也相对较快。 总之,在选择钱包的时候,一定要了解自己的需求并做好相应的风险评估,选择适合自己的钱包是十分重要的。